1. Wire Hangers These are the most common type used to support grid systems. They are typically made from high-strength steel wire and are anchored to the building’s structural elements, such as beams or joists. Wire hangers provide flexibility during installation and allow for easy adjustments.

3. Lockable Access Panels For spaces that require added security, lockable panels are an excellent choice. These panels restrict access to authorized personnel, making them ideal for sensitive areas such as server rooms or medical facilities.

Fire resistance is another notable characteristic of rigid mineral wool board. Made from non-combustible materials, these boards can withstand high temperatures and do not emit toxic fumes when exposed to fire. This feature contributes to the overall safety of buildings and is compliant with various fire safety regulations. Consequently, they are frequently used in applications that require strict fire safety standards.
